Threads of Gold

the strongest bonds are invisible, yet they hold everything together.

Mariam had grown up believing that her family was ordinary, like countless others in her quiet town. But on her grandmother’s last birthday, she discovered a secret woven into the fabric of her ancestry—one that had been carefully preserved across generations.

Her grandmother, a stoic woman with eyes that seemed to hold centuries of wisdom, handed Mariam a small, worn pouch. Inside were thin, golden threads. “These,” she whispered, “connect us—not just as a family, but as a chain of choices, sacrifices, and love. Each thread carries a story, a lesson, a memory. You must learn to recognize them, and someday, you’ll add your own.”

Mariam was skeptical at first. How could threads of gold—mere strands of fiber—hold meaning beyond their appearance? Yet as her grandmother began to tell the stories, the threads seemed to shimmer with significance. One thread belonged to a great-aunt who had crossed oceans to start a new life; another to a grandfather who had worked tirelessly to protect the family during hard times. Each one represented courage, resilience, and the quiet strength of those who came before her.

Curious, Mariam began tracing the threads through the house. They wound through drawers, hidden beneath floorboards, and even within the seams of old quilts. Each thread led her to a memory, a photograph, a letter that revealed the struggles and triumphs of ancestors she had never met. She began to understand that her life was not isolated; it was a continuation of countless choices, sacrifices, and acts of love stretching back through generations.

One evening, Mariam’s father found her sitting by the fire, threads spread across her lap. “What are you doing?” he asked, amusement in his voice.

“I’m seeing who we are,” Mariam replied softly. “These threads—they connect everything. They remind me that we’re stronger than we think, because of each other.”

Her father studied her, and for a moment, the stoic mask he always wore softened. He took a thread gently from her hand. “Your grandmother was right,” he said. “These aren’t just threads—they’re lessons. And now, it’s time for you to add yours.”

Mariam understood. That night, she began weaving her own golden thread into the collection. She thought of her small acts of kindness, her choices to stand by her family, and the courage it took to follow her own dreams while honoring their legacy. Each thread became part of a tapestry larger than herself, a living chronicle of connection, love, and continuity.

Over the years, Mariam added more threads, each one a marker of a life lived with intention. When she had children of her own, she passed down the pouch, teaching them to trace the threads, to listen to the stories, and to contribute their own. The threads of gold never faded; they only grew stronger, linking the past, present, and future in an unbroken chain.

Mariam realized that family was not just blood—it was memory, courage, and love stitched together over time. And though the threads were invisible to most, they were the foundation upon which everything in her life rested.

In the quiet of her room, as she traced a particularly luminous thread, Mariam whispered a thank you to the generations before her, and a promise to those yet to come: that she would honor their stories, preserve their strength, and continue weaving the tapestry of her family, thread by golden thread.
